The European Week for Waste Reduction is looking for more coordinators! Its 14th edition is approaching, and thousands of people are already working for the organisation of practical actions on the promotion of waste prevention. Why not you? From 19 to 27 November, join us for the biggest European raising-awareness campaign focused on waste reduction and circular economy. This year, the campaign explores the impact of the textile and clothing industry on the planet and society. The aim is to raise awareness on this topic among EWWR action developers, inspiring them to take active action to promote a circular change and reduce textile waste. Regional and national coordinators play a key part in the campaign by promoting it and its messages all over Europe. Coordinators are public authorities that have competences in the field of waste management. It is also possible to delegate the main tasks to an associate organisation.
